When it comes to maintenance, use a soft brush to remove dirt after each use. You can clean the leather with a mild leather cleaner and then apply a leather conditioner to keep it soft and supple. Avoid getting the boots soaked in water for long periods. If they do get wet, let them dry naturally away from direct heat. Check the soles regularly for any signs of excessive wear, and if needed, take them to a professional cobbler for repair.
